User: d_jencks Date: 02/03/08 13:02:07 Modified: . build.xml Log: testcase for bug 526465, make sure failed deploys cleans up after itself Revision Changes Path 1.87 +38 -1 jbosstest/build.xml Index: build.xml =================================================================== RCS file: /cvsroot/jboss/jbosstest/build.xml,v retrieving revision 1.86 retrieving revision 1.87 diff -u -r1.86 -r1.87 --- build.xml 7 Mar 2002 17:03:54 -0000 1.86 +++ build.xml 8 Mar 2002 21:02:06 -0000 1.87 @@ -28,7 +28,7 @@ <!-- tests-jmxri-compliance still needs to run over jmxri.jar --> <!-- the aim of that test is to check our compliance suite. --> -<!-- $Id: build.xml,v 1.86 2002/03/07 17:03:54 neales Exp $ --> +<!-- $Id: build.xml,v 1.87 2002/03/08 21:02:06 d_jencks Exp $ --> <project default="main" name="JBoss/Testsuite"> @@ -506,6 +506,32 @@ mergedir="${source.resources}/cmp2/cmr/"/> </xdoclet> + +<!--undeploy of broken packages--> + <mkdir dir="${build.resources}/jmx/undeploy/META-INF"/> + <xdoclet sourcepath="${source.java}" + destdir="${build.gen-src}" + classpath="${xdoclet.task.classpath}" + ejbspec="2.0" + excludedtags="@version,@author"> + <!--mergedir="${source.resources}/jmx/ejb"--> + <fileset dir="${source.java}"> + <include name="org/jboss/test/jmx/ejb/Entity*Bean.java"/> + </fileset> + <packageSubstitution packages="ejb" substituteWith="interfaces"/> + <remoteinterface/> + <localinterface/> + <homeinterface/> + <localhomeinterface/> + <!--session/--> + <deploymentdescriptor xmlencoding ="UTF-8" + destdir="${build.resources}/jmx/undeploy/META-INF"/> + <jboss xmlencoding="UTF-8" + version="3.0" + destdir="${build.resources}/jmx/undeploy/META-INF" + mergedir="${source.resources}/jmx/undeploy/"/> + </xdoclet> + </target> <target name="compile-mbean-sources" depends="init"> @@ -1241,6 +1267,17 @@ </fileset> <fileset dir="${build.resources}/jmx/mbeana"> <include name="META-INF/jboss-service.xml"/> + </fileset> + </jar> + + <!--package with external jndi dependencies, for undeploy of broken package--> + <jar jarfile="${build.lib}/undeploybroken.jar"> + <fileset dir="${build.classes}"> + <include name="org/jboss/test/jmx/ejb/Entity*.class"/> + <include name="org/jboss/test/jmx/interfaces/Entity*.class"/> + </fileset> + <fileset dir="${build.resources}/jmx/undeploy"> + <include name="META-INF/*.xml"/> </fileset> </jar>
_______________________________________________ Jboss-development mailing list [EMAIL PROTECTED] https://lists.sourceforge.net/lists/listinfo/jboss-development